Adam Lyon lost life in Supersport race
An inquest into the death of a 26-year-old competitor at this year's TT Races will continue later.
Adam Craig Lyon, from Helensburgh in Argyll, was killed in a crash in the Supersport race on Monday, 4 June.
The court has already heard how the Scotsman, a TT newcomer, sustained fatal head injuries in the incident at Casey's, near the 28th milestone.
Coroner of Inquests John Needham will reconvene proceedings at Douglas Courthouse at 2pm.
